List of BMW Petrol and Diesel engines

List of BMW Petrol and Diesel engines

 

Gasoline/petrol piston engines

Straight-three

  • 2013–present – 1.2/1.5 L B38

Straight-four

  • 1960–1984 – 1.5–2.0 L M10
  • 1986–1990 – 2.0–2.5 L S14
  • 1987–1995 – 1.6/1.8 L M40
  • 1989–1996 – 1.8 L M42
  • 1991–2002 – 1.6/1.8/1.9 L M43
  • 1996–2001 – 1.9 L M44
  • 2001–2004 – 1.6 L N40
  • 2001–2004 – 1.8/2.0 L N42
  • 2004–2007 – 1.8/2.0 L N46
  • 2004–2011 – 1.6/2.0 L N45
  • 2007–2011 – 1.6/2.0 L N43
  • 2011–present – 2.0 L N20
  • 2013–present – 1.6 L N20
  • 2011–present – 1.6 L N13
  • 2012–present – 2.0 L N26
  • 2013–present – 2.0 L B48

Straight-six

BMW is famous for its straight six engines, which have powered many of their most popular models.

  • 1933–1950 – 1.2-1.9 L M78
  • 1936–1940 – 2.0-2.1 L M328
  • 1939–1941 – 3.5 L M335
  • 1952–1958 – 2.0-2.1 L M337
  • 1968–1994 – 2.5-3.5 L M30
  • 1977–1993 – 2.0-2.7 L M20
  • 1978–1989 – 3.5 L M88/S38
  • 1980–1982 – 3.2 L M102
  • 1982–1986 – 3.4 L M106
  • 1989–1996 – 2.0-2.5 L M50
  • 1992–1999 – 3.0/3.2 L S50
  • 1994–2000 – 2.0-2.8 L M52
  • 1996–2000 – 3.2 L S52
  • 2000–2006 – 2.2-3.0 L M54
  • 2000–2008 – 3.2 L S54
  • 2002–2005 – 2.5 L M56
  • 2005–2015 – 2.5-3.0 L N52
  • 2006–present – 3.0 L N54 (as of 2015)
  • 2007–2014 – 2.5-3.0 L N53
  • 2009–present – 3.0 L N55
  • 2014–present – 3.0 L S55
  • 2015–present – 3.0 L B58

V8

  • 1951–1965 - 2.6-3.2 L "BMW OHV V8"
  • 1992–1996 - 3.0-4.0 L M60
  • 1996–2005 - 3.5-4.4 L M62
  • 1998–2006 - 4.9-5.0 L S62
  • 2000–2005 - 4.0 L P60B40
  • 2001–2010 - 3.6-4.8 L N62 (still used in Morgan Aero 8 as of 2017)
  • 2007–2013 - 4.0 L S65
  • 2008–present - 4.4 L N63
  • 2009–present - 4.4 L S63

V10

  • 2005–2010 - 5.0 L S85

V12

List of BMW Petrol and Diesel v12 engines

  • 1987–1996 - 5.0 L M70
  • 1992–1996 - 5.6 L S70
  • 1993–2002 - 5.4 L M73
  • 1993–2000 - 6.1 L S70/2
  • 1999 - 6.0 L P75
  • 2003–2008 - 6.0 L N73
  • 2009–present - 6.0 L N74
  • 2016–present - 6.6 L N74

V16

  • 1987 - 6.7 L Goldfish (M70 V12 based prototype)
  • 2004 - 9.0 L - Rolls-Royce 100EX V16 engine prototype

Diesel piston engines

Straight-three

  • 2012–present – 1.5 L B37

Straight-four

  • 1994–2000 – 1.7 L M41
  • 1998–2006 – 2.0 L M47
  • 2006–present – 2.0 L N47
  • 2013–present – 2.0 L B47

Straight-six

  • 1983–1993 – 2.4 L M21
  • 1991–2000 – 2.5 L M51
  • 1998–present – 2.5-3.0 L M57
  • 2008–present – 2.5-3.0 L N57
  • 2015–present – 3.0 L B57

V8

  • 1998-2009 - 3.9-4.4 L M67
